Description:
"'Reading, Writing, and 'Rithmatic!'; These youngsters have a segregated home of their own on the leprosarium grounds, for they are the perfectly healthy children of parents who are patients in the main compound. Here a group of them are shown in one of their regular school sessions. Benches serve as desks, not seats."

Description:
Dr. Milton T. Stauffer, General Secretary of the John Milton Society for the Blind, New York, and Mrs. Stauffer observe a class of blind children reading English braille at the Korean National Institute for the Deaf and Blind in Seoul, during Dr. Stauffer's one-week visit here to study Korea's facilities for caring for the blind and deaf.

Description:
Taken in Feb. 1957, at a Presbyterian Bible Class in Andong - Central Presbyterian Ch. This Ch. was built by the Korean Christians in 1935 - still in good condition, although used by Japanese in W.W. #2, also by the Commis in 1950. Not all the women are in this picture - some had gone home earlier.

Description:
"Leprosarium Staff. Here are the ones who try to keep the institution ticking along smoothly. The problems are great, and many, but Philippians 4:19 is just as true today as it was in the time of St. Paul: 'My God shall supply all your needs according to His riches in glory, by Christ Jesus.' Praise be to Him who cares for us. Seated: (left to right) Mr. Kim, pastor; Dr. Moffett, Acting Supt.; Mr. Pai, Asst. Supt. Standing: Mr. Kwun, business manager; errand boy; Mr. Pak, agriculturalist; Mr. Choon, office worker; Mr. Chun, mechanic and truck driver; maintenance helper. These are the only people directly connected to the institution who are not patients. Not a single Korean doctor due to natural reluctance, if not fear, of associating with cases of leprosy. Interns and residents from Taegu Presbyterian Hospital do give valuable assistance for a few hours each week."
